In July, Beaune, France, experiences a delightful mix of summer warmth and refreshing humidity. With average temperatures hovering around 22°C (71°F), the region can occasionally soar to a maximum of 40°C (104°F), offering both sizzling days and cooler evenings, where temperatures can dip to a mellow 9°C (49°F). While visitors can bask in the sun, they should be prepared for occasional rain, as the month sees an average precipitation of 55 mm (2.2 in) over about 8 days, accompanied by a humidity level of 79% that adds a touch of lushness to the landscape. July Precipitation in Beaune

In July, Beaune experiences a moderate precipitation level of 55 mm (2.2 in), accompanied by 8 days of rain. This marks a slight decline from the wetter months preceding it, such as May and June, which brought 89 mm and 75 mm, respectively. The drier conditions in July, typical for the region, create a pleasant summer atmosphere, making it ideal for exploring Beaune’s famed vineyards. As the month winds down, the trends hint at a shift towards the slightly less humid August, which averages around 46 mm of rainfall over 8 days. July UV Index in Beaune

In Beaune, France, July boasts a UV Index of 9, indicating a very high risk of harm from unprotected sun exposure. This peak aligns with the trends observed since May, where the index gradually escalated from moderate readings of 5 in March to the current summer high. With a burn time of just 15 minutes, it's crucial for sun seekers to take protective measures such as wearing sunscreen and protective clothing. This pattern of heightened UV levels continues into August, before tapering off in the fall. UV Risk Categories

  •  Extreme (11+): Avoid the sun, stay in shade.
  •  Very High (8-10): Limit sun exposure.
  •  High (6-7): Use SPF 30+ and protective clothing.
  •  Moderate (3-5): Midday shade recommended.
  •  Low (0-2): No protection needed.
